Job summary

Sysco is seeking a Transportation Manager for the Woodridge, IL area to oversee the safe, efficient, and timely delivery of products. You will monitor driver performance, manage equipment condition and business volume, and optimize expenses in a dynamic distribution environment.

The role requires 4–8 years of transportation management experience, solid computer and routing platform skills, and knowledge of DOT regulations. CDL preferred; union experience is a plus.

Qualifications

  • 4–8 years of transportation management experience.
  • Strong computer experience and routing platforms.
  • Knowledge of DOT regulations; CDL preferred.
  • Union experience preferred (optional)

Responsibilities

  • Closely monitor driver performance via available technology and control features.
  • Maintain detailed records of driver pay, equipment maintenance, and equipment performance.
  • Review driver logs to ensure accuracy and DOT adherence.
  • Monitor equipment for safe operation and minimal breakdowns.
  • Plan and schedule transportation personnel assignments.
  • Process bi-weekly payroll and verify vendor invoices.
  • Monitor monthly expenses related to planning and make necessary changes.
  • Ensure DOT regulatory compliance and safety practices within the department.

Important Notice for CDL Holders: If you hold a valid Class A or B Commercial Driver’s License (CDL), you will be designated as a CDL driver for Sysco, regardless of the specific position for which you are applying. As a result, this classification may affect your job responsibilities and will subject you to compliance requirements under Department of Transportation (DOT) regulations — including participation in the DOT Drug and Alcohol Random Testing Program. Candidates must have: • Be 21 years or older • No drug or alcohol violations within the past 3 years • No open violations listed in the FMCSA Drug and Alcohol Clearinghouse**OVERVIEW:**Sysco is the global leader in foodservice distribution.
